Compare performance (446 HP vs 510 HP), boot space and price (56,900 £ vs 55,700 £ ) at a glance. Find out which car is the better choice for you – Ford Mustang Convertible or MG Cyberster?
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.
MG Cyberster is only slightly cheaper – starting at 55,700 £ , while the Ford Mustang Convertible costs 56,900 £ . That’s a price difference of around 1,209 £.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the MG Cyberster offers somewhat more power – delivering 510 HP compared to 446 HP. That’s roughly 64 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the MG Cyberster is substantially quicker – completing the sprint in 3.2 s, while the Ford Mustang Convertible takes 5 s. That’s about 1.8 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the MG Cyberster delivers markedly more torque with 725 Nm compared to 540 Nm. That’s about 185 Nm more.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Seats: Ford Mustang Convertible offers more seats – 4 vs 2.
In terms of curb weight, Ford Mustang Convertible is very slightly lighter – 1,876 kg compared to 1,960 kg. The difference is around 84 kg.
When it comes to payload, the Ford Mustang Convertible carries substantially more – 324 kg compared to 150 kg. That’s a difference of about 174 kg.
The MG Cyberster is clearly superior overall in the objective data comparison.
